Plot
Edit
Winter has come to Sherman, Illinois. Ilana, as she gazes out across the snow scape, watching children and families happily playing, is reminded of Galaluna's Harvest Festival, until Lance interrupts her daydreaming.
Meanwhile, on Galaluna, General Modula muses about what he can do to crush the spirit of the people, as music and laughter drift across the planet. An Alien Mobster approaches him, offering on his own life the beast he has that will crush the princess, as rumors of Modula's continued failure has been spreading.
At school, Ilana, feeling homesick, notices a poster for the Homecoming dance, and she is delighted. quickly discovering the meeting room, she lays her idea in beautiful detail of a Harvest Festival theme upon the other two members of the planning staff, Todd and Merideth. Having no idea of their own for the dance, and moved by her beautiful discription, they accept her idea almost immediately.
Outside, Newton and Kimmy are talking about the dance, when Brandon and his friends attack them with snowballs. Newton quickly drives them off. Kimmy asks him to take her to the dance, which he agrees to do, but only if Lance and Ilana come. Kimmy grudgingly agrees, but only if they have dates.
Modula tests the beast in "the Pit" where it wipes out it's opponents with it's incredible speed. impressed, he orders it sent to Earth.
Lance goes looking for Ilana, and finds out from her and Newton that he's been shanghaied into going to the dance. Lance warns Ilana not to get too excited, as she'll just be disappointed in the end. Ilana defensively denies that she is too excited.
The three, along with Kimmy, go shopping for outfits. Lance uncomfortably gets fitted for a Tux, as Newton squeezes into his, before finally resorting to altering his form to be much slimmer and more attractive, much to Kimmy's delight. As Kimmy drags Ilana off to get a dress, Lance sends a glance to Kristen, as he contemplates his Date scenario.
Later, at school, Lance notices Kristen practicing martial arts in the gym. impressed, he goes over to her, and the two engage in a quick duel, which Lance soundly wins with his military training. He asks her to the dance, but she declines, saying it's not really her thing.
The night finally arrives, and Lance, finally resigning to the tux, Ilana, who feels uncomfortable in the skimpy dresses Kimmy provided, and Newton, who is practicing "smooth" poses, get together with their dates: Jason, who is taking Ilana, Kimmy, and Merideth, one of the Homecoming planners, a short pudgy girl, who lance asked to get Ilana off his back.
after Photos and the arrival of a limo, everything seems ot be going well....and then Newton tenses, to Kimmy's dismay ,as she knows at least some of what this means: the rift gate has opened, AKA Newton has to "use the bathroom"
Kimmy is heartbroken as Newton sadly leaves, promising to come back, and calls her friends to tearfully tell them what happened. Jason and Merideth awkwardly ride with her to the school.
As the Titan flies toward the landing site of the creature, Octus and Ilana reflect on their lost evening, while Lance, who never wanted to go anyway, is focused on the mission.
Kimmy arrives at the dance, and runs to her friends, sobbing. Jason and Merideth sit alone at a table, waiting for thier "dates"
Octus regrets that he made Kimmy cry, while Ilana is disappointed that she won't get her Harvest festival. Lance, meanwhile shouts at them to focus, as they engage the monster, who's superior speed is knocking them left and right.
at the dance, Kimmy and Brandon are made Homecoming king and queen, and are crowned as Kimmy looks forlornly at the door, waiting for Newton. As she dances with Brandon, who says he's never treat her like Newton apparently is, Jason and Merideth decide to dance with each other.
Finally, As Lance shouts that the three are going to die because Octus and Ilana are too worried about a "stupid Dance" Ilana finally snaps, thrashing the beast as she shouts that it's more than a dance, it's home. they quickly dispatch the creature. as they revert to human, Newton gazes off, saying that he has to go.
at Kimmy's house, newton throws pebbles at her bedroom window to get her attention, and she finally answers after he breaks it. After an awkward stereo "music" attempt by Newton, Kimmy calmly tells Newton that she's breaking up with him: she feels that he's keeping a secret from her. Newton seems about to tell her what he is, but she just tells him to go away.
at the dance, Ilana wanders in as the Janitors clean up. Lance follows her, surprised: he didn't even know what the theme was. as Ilana stands forlorn in the middle of the room, lance turns the music on, and puts on a hat similar to the one the King wore at the festival. the two dance around, laughing. On Galaluna, Modula, after killing the mobster, ponders what he will do next...
